expert floor sanding in BishopsgateBringing your floor back into great condition is a painstaking process. The floor sanding craftsmen have the skills and tools to complete any of the following jobs:

Repair and Restoration: Before sanding, we hammer down or remove old nails and and repair weakened joists or loose floorboards. Sometimes it's necessary to replace badly damaged wood - we do this with reclaimed timber that matches the original flooring.

Gap Filling: Filling gaps that have resulted from shrinkage will result in a more even final result. We fill lager gaps with reclaimed wood, which is hammered in and smoothed flat, and smaller ones with a resin and sawdust mix.

Floor Sanding: Working from coarse to fine grain sandpaper, the wood floor restoration team will smooth your old floor until it's ready to receive colour or sealing compounds.

Floor Staining: Choose a colour that will enhance the appearance of a room and complement your chosen furnishings.

Floor Sealing: We use a range of Bona and Junkers lacquers. Depending on the age and style of your flooring and the amount of wear it will receive, we may recommend a natural wax or oil, or a more hard-wearing varnish. We generally apply three coats of lacquer or two coats of wax.

Keeping Your Wood Floor in Great Condition

A few simple steps will guard against the most common causes of damage to wooden floors:

Scratches: Dirt and grit are your number one enemies. In your home, make your wood-floored rooms shoe-free if at all possible. In commercial properties doormats at entrances will reduce the grit carried into the room.

Water Damage: Mop up spills promptly - fluids will sit on your sealed floor, giving you time to remove them before they can penetrate any scratches in your water resistant sealant..

Furniture: Prevent drag marks by lifting heavy furniture when you move it. Make it a two person job if necessary to protect your back!
